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YCZ_APEP - HRCZ: APEP - messages
Message number: 082
Message text: Not supported by authority before 1.1.2020! Check SAP Note 2852292.

- Not supported by authority before 1.1.2020! Check SAP Note 2852292. ?The SAP error message HRPAYCZ_APEP082: Not supported by authority before 1.1.2020! Check SAP Note 2852292 typically relates to issues in the Czech payroll processing module within SAP. This error indicates that certain functionalities or processes are not supported for dates prior to January 1, 2020, likely due to changes in legislation or system updates.
Cause:
- Legislative Changes: The error is often a result of changes in Czech payroll legislation that took effect on January 1, 2020. This could involve new rules or regulations that the system must adhere to.
- Configuration Issues: The payroll configuration may not be set up to handle data or processes for periods before the specified date.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the action related to payroll processing for the specified period.
Solution:
- Check SAP Note 2852292: This note provides specific guidance and updates related to the error. It may contain patches, configuration steps, or additional information on how to resolve the issue.
- Update Payroll Configuration: Ensure that the payroll configuration is updated to reflect the changes in legislation. This may involve applying support packages or updates that address the changes.
- User Authorizations: Verify that the user has the appropriate authorizations to perform payroll processing. If not, the necessary roles and permissions should be assigned.
- Consult with SAP Support: If the issue persists after checking the note and updating configurations, it may be necessary to reach out to SAP support for further assistance.
